D. H. B. Chritzman was born in 1868 at Welsh Run, the son of Dr. Henry G. Chritzman. He attended the Welsh Run Academy, Mercersburg College and Lafayette College, Easton, Pa. He then read medicine with his father and attended lectures at the Jefferson Medical College, Philadelphia, Pa., graduating M. D. in 1889 from this institution. Dr. Chritzman located at once in Greencastle, Pa., and practiced medicine here until 1896, when he removed to Welsh Run. Several years later he located in Mercersburg, where he is now in active practice. Dr. H. B. Chritzman was a member of the Medical Society in 1894 and for several years thereafter. He married first, Alice Keefer of Chambersburg, Pa.
